Whenever I play Sven coop, teamfortress 2, or any other steam multiplayer games I type net_graph 2 or 3 to see fps, loss, in, out, choke, and ping, My ping is fine, my fps is fine, but there is a problem with the "in" and "out". The "in" raises up much higher than "out". For example in Teamfortress 2 my in would be around 400-700 and my "out" would drop to around below 100, and would cause me to lag and make me retrace steps. For Sven Coop the "in" would rise up to around 600-700 while my "out" is around 10-20. I'm not sure whats going on and is there a why to fix this. If you would like to know I have cable high speed internet, and I am directly connected to the modem.

In hl1 games it shows packet count and bandwidth usage in kb/s. In source it shows that , but the last one is updates per second. Are you sure your rate is high enough? Mine is set to 30000, or in other words about 30kb/s, a low rate setting will cause lag when there's a lot of action.

One of the other things it could be is that your internet connection might be getting saturated with traffic. Your cable connection is shared with neighbors in your neighborhood, they might be using up all of the bandwidth, causing you lag, if you get a very inconsistent download speed on it it might meant that it's getting saturated with traffic. Not much you can do about it except to get a different isp. You could try to ping your isp's gateway ip address and see if you get random lag spikes in the ping.
